Escape to the historic Rideout House, a 200-year-old property listed on the national register of historic places. Immerse yourself in the rich history of this property as you step inside its doors. This expansive 6-bedroom, 6-bathroom home boasts 4,500 square feet of living space spread across 2 and a half stories, perfect for families who want to vacation together yet still have their own private spaces.

The living room, featuring wide beam reclaimed barn wood floors, welcomes you to this charming abode. The spacious and well-appointed kitchen provides plenty of light and connects to two dining areas, allowing ample space for large groups to gather comfortably.

Step outside and discover the tranquility of the backyard, where a quiet private stream and firepit provide a perfect spot for relaxation. The adjacent Cold Spring Brook Park, recently restored by the community of Weston, provides additional outdoor recreation opportunities.

Located in the heart of small-town Weston, the Rideout House is just a short walk from the world-famous Weston Playhouse and Vermont Country Store. Take a short 16-minute drive to Okemo Mountain or the town of Ludlow for even more entertainment options.

This home sits on the foothills of the Green Mountains, with Okemo (16min), Magic Mountain (11min), Bromley (17 minutes), and Stratton (41min) within easy reach. Hiking enthusiasts will delight in the endless trails nearby, while Wantastiquet pond, just a 5-minute drive up Lawrence Hill Road, provides opportunities for fishing and boating at the nearby Wantastiquet Trout Club.

Foodies will appreciate the farm-to-table offerings in nearby Weston, Londonderry, and Ludlow, with an array of innovative, delicious, and extremely fresh meals. Don't miss out on nationally recognized Grandma Miller’s bakery, just a 15-minute drive away. Summers (May-Oct) bring the local farmers market to Londonderry, adding to the array of culinary delights in the area.
